>Description:

NEW PORT: /comms/xdx is a DX cluster client with the same look and feel as xlog

--- xdx-1.2.shar begins here ---
# This is a shell archive.  Save it in a file, remove anything before
# this line, and then unpack it by entering "sh file".  Note, it may
# create directories; files and directories will be owned by you and
# have default permissions.
#
# This archive contains:
#
#	comms/xdx
#	comms/xdx/Makefile
#	comms/xdx/pkg-plist
#	comms/xdx/pkg-descr
#	comms/xdx/distinfo
#
echo c - comms/xdx
mkdir -p comms/xdx > /dev/null 2>&1
echo x - comms/xdx/Makefile
sed 's/^X//' >comms/xdx/Makefile << 'END-of-comms/xdx/Makefile'
X# New ports collection makefile for:	xdx
X# Date created:		2004-05-21
X# Whom:			Matt Dawson <matt@mattsnetwork.co.uk>
X#
X# $FreeBSD$
X
XPORTNAME=	xdx
XPORTVERSION=	1.2
XCATEGORIES=	comms
XMASTER_SITES=   http://www.qsl.net/pg4i/download/
X
XMAINTAINER=	matt@mattsnetwork.co.uk
XCOMMENT=	Amateur Radio DX cluster monitor
X
XUSE_X_PREFIX=	yes
XUSE_GNOME=	pkgconfig gtk20
XGNU_CONFIGURE=	yes
XUSE_GMAKE=	yes
X
XMAN1=		xdx.1
X
X.include <bsd.port.mk>
END-of-comms/xdx/Makefile
echo x - comms/xdx/pkg-plist
sed 's/^X//' >comms/xdx/pkg-plist << 'END-of-comms/xdx/pkg-plist'
Xbin/xdx
Xshare/xdx/MANUAL
Xshare/xdx/MANUAL.es
Xshare/xdx/pixmaps/bigsmile.png
Xshare/xdx/pixmaps/cry.png
Xshare/xdx/pixmaps/sad.png
Xshare/xdx/pixmaps/smile.png
Xshare/xdx/pixmaps/wink.png
Xshare/xdx/pixmaps/xdx.png
Xshare/xdx/pixmaps/xdx.xcf
Xshare/xdx/pixmaps/xdx.xpm
X@dirrm share/xdx/pixmaps
X@dirrm share/xdx
END-of-comms/xdx/pkg-plist
echo x - comms/xdx/pkg-descr
sed 's/^X//' >comms/xdx/pkg-descr << 'END-of-comms/xdx/pkg-descr'
XXdx is a client to connect to a DX-cluster. Dx messages will be 
Xdisplayed in a list, announcements will go to a text display.
X
XAs well as the usual functions, if you have hamlib installed
Xit can control the radio and set the frequency simply by double
Xclicking a DX-spot (using rigctl).
X
XWWW: http://www.qsl.net/pg4i/linux/xdx.html
END-of-comms/xdx/pkg-descr
echo x - comms/xdx/distinfo
sed 's/^X//' >comms/xdx/distinfo << 'END-of-comms/xdx/distinfo'
XMD5 (xdx-1.2.tar.gz) = 3bdb706eec933c002984c2d49af6baf3
XSIZE (xdx-1.2.tar.gz) = 204680
END-of-comms/xdx/distinfo
exit
--- xdx-1.2.shar ends here ---
